My local hill bought the buoys, and hold a Carving Cup style race once a year. We might have had a second race this year in March, but The weather put paid to that. It's a very fun way to race, and unlike other FIS racing, this has few rules, other than course requirements (for the real races, not ours). The best are no speed suits, and no poles :D
